So out flying tonight and as I retracted the gear, I noticed the left main light dimly lit. Prior to take off all three very bright.

I switched to LEDs several years ago and they stay bright all the time. The NAV lights dimmer does not effect the brightness.

Gear was fully retracted and it stayed on (dim) the entire flight until I put the gear down and then came back on bright, normal. I switched the dimmer off in flight, no change. No gear in transit or unsafe lights.

I did just give the plane a bath a couple weeks ago and haven’t flown it at night until tonight, so it may have happened after the wash. I’ll check again during the day Thursday or Friday to see if it is lit.

Gear is acting and functioning normal, just the dim light. Any ideas?
